Elevate Your Exhibition and Conference Experience with Professional Front of House Staff in London
Elevate Your Exhibition and Conference Experience with Professional Front of House Staff in London Exhibitions and conferences in London are dynamic events that bring together industry professionals, innovators, and enthusiasts under one roof. The success of these events relies not…